Usage examples of "bolsa" in Spanish with translation to English

<>
No puedo encontrar mi bolsa. I can't find my bag.
Perdió una fortuna en la bolsa. He lost a fortune in the stock market.
El muchacho robó dinero de la bolsa de su madre. The boy stole money from his mother's handbag.
Me robaron mi bolsa en el probador. I had my purse stolen in the changing room.
¿Me podría enseñar esta bolsa? Could you show me this bag?
Era un día muy tranquilo en la bolsa de valores. It was a very calm day in the stock market.
¿Qué bolsa es la tuya? Which bag is yours?
Mi abuelo amasó una gran fortuna en la bolsa de valores y luego, de la noche a la mañana, lo perdió todo. My grandfather amassed a great fortune in the stock market and then lost it all over night.
¿De quién es esta bolsa? Whose is this bag?
¿Es tuya esa bolsa negra? Is that black bag yours?
Por favor, abra su bolsa. Please open your bag.
Tengo que esconder esta bolsa. I have to hide this bag.
Ésta no es mi bolsa. This isn't my bag.
La bolsa se quedó atrás. The bag has been left behind.
Pagué 200 dólares por esta bolsa. I paid $200 for this bag.
El ladrón se llevó mi bolsa. The thief ran off with my bag.
¿Es ésta la bolsa de Tom? Is this Tom's bag?
El hombre le robó su bolsa. The man robbed her of her bag.
Su bolsa estaba llena de agua. His bag was filled with water.
Hay algunos libros en la bolsa. There are a few books in the bag.
